Índice (8 secciones)
¿Por qué aprender programación en línea?
La programación es una habilidad valiosa en el mundo actual digitalizado. Aprender a programar online te permite flexibilidad, acceso a variedad de recursos y la capacidad de aprender a tu propio ritmo. Según Code.org, la demanda de perfiles tecnológicos supera las ofertas en cerca de dos a uno.
Ventajas del aprendizaje online
Muchas plataformas ofrecen cursos gratuitos y pagos que se adaptan a diversos niveles de experiencia. Según un estudio de Coursera, el 78% de sus estudiantes consideran la flexibilidad del aprendizaje online un factor crítico.
Los 10 mejores cursos de programación online
- Curso de Introducción a Python de Codecademy
Codecademy ofrece un curso intensivo de Python ideal para principiantes. Python es versátil y fácil de aprender, lo que lo hace perfecto para quienes se inician en la programación. Este curso incluye ejercicios prácticos y proyectos pequeños para afianzar lo aprendido.
- CS50 de Harvard en edX
El curso CS50 de Harvard es famoso por su enfoque exhaustivo en la informática y la programación. Aunque es desafiante, es accesible para principiantes. Incluye conferencias, proyectos y un entorno de discusión comunitaria activo.
- Desarrollo Web Full Stack de The Odin Project
The Odin Project proporciona un currículo gratuito robusto que cubre HTML, CSS, JavaScript, y más. Su enfoque basado en proyectos ayuda a los estudiantes a construir un portafolio sólido para mostrarse a posibles empleadores.
- Java Programming and Software Engineering Fundamentals de Coursera
Ofrecido por Duke University, este curso te lleva desde los fundamentos hasta conceptos avanzados de Java. Coursera hace uso de videos didácticos que facilitan la comprensión de estructuras de datos y algoritmos.
- HTML y CSS para Creaciones Visuales de Platzi
Platzi se enfoca en la creatividad visual enseñando HTML y CSS. Este curso es perfecto para diseñadores que desean entender el lenguaje del web. Su comunidad activa permite resolver dudas rápidamente.
Comparación de Plataformas
| Plataforma | Nivel Iniciación | Modelo de Pago | Comunidad |
|---|---|---|---|
| Codecademy | Alto | Freemium | Activa |
| edX | Medio | Gratuito/Pago | Moderada |
| The Odin Project | Alto | Gratuito | Activa |
| Coursera | Bajo | Pago | Activa |
FAQ
- ¿Cuál es el mejor lenguaje para comenzar a programar?
Python es altamente recomendado para principiantes debido a su sintaxis clara y aplicaciones versátiles.
- ¿Son los cursos online reconocidos por empleadores?
Sí, muchos empleadores valoran la autodisciplina y la iniciativa demostradas por los cursos online.
- ¿Es necesario comprar certificados al final del curso?
Esto depende de tus objetivos. Los certificados pueden ayudar a demostrar tu aprendizaje a empleadores potenciales.
- ¿Cuántos cursos debo tomar a la vez como principiante?
Es aconsejable comenzar con uno solo para no sentirse abrumado y poder enfocar tu atención al máximo.
Glossaire
| Terme | Définition |
|---|---|
| Algoritmo | Conjunto de instrucciones para resolver un problema específico |
| Framework | Herramienta que provee funcionalidades genéricas para agilizar el desarrollo |
| Debugging | Proceso de identificación y eliminación de errores en un programa |
- [ ] Investigar plataformas disponibles
- [ ] Evaluar si prefieres un modelo gratuito o de pago
- [ ] Considerar el tiempo que puedes dedicar semanalmente
- [ ] Comprobar si hay soporte de comunidad
- [ ] Verificar que el curso incluye proyectos prácticos
🧠 Quiz rápido: ¿Qué curso debería elegir si quiero aprender programación y diseño web al mismo tiempo?
- A) CS50 de edX
- B) HTML y CSS para Creaciones Visuales de Platzi
- C) Java Programming de Coursera
Respuesta: B — Platzi cubre específicamente el diseño web visual.

